What are the principles and characteristics of joint cross bearing?

3,292 Published by Nov 01,2019

Principle of joint cross bearing
Joint cross bearing is also called cross roller bearing. Their rollers are arranged at right angles to each other at intervals between the inner and outer wheels. They can withstand loads from all directions at the same time. Since the roller is in linear contact with the track surface, the joint cross bearing is less likely to be elastically deformed by the load.
Joint cross bearing is widely used in industrial robots, work machines and medical facilities, where high rigidity, tightness and high speed are required to ensure accuracy.

The principle of joint cross bearing:
The rollers of the joint cross bearing are mainly cylindrical rollers, and the cylindrical rollers are arranged at right angles to each other at intervals between the inner and outer rings of the bearing. They can withstand loads from all directions (such as axial, thrust or momentum loads).
The internal structure of the joint cross bearing is arranged at 90° perpendicular to each other by rollers. The spacers or spacers are arranged between the rollers to prevent the rollers from tilting between the rollers and prevent the rotation torque. increase.
In addition, the contact phenomenon or the locking phenomenon of the roller does not occur; at the same time, since the inner and outer rings are divided structures, the gap can be adjusted, and even if it is pre-compressed by the family, high-precision rotary motion can be obtained.

Joint cross bearing features:
1, joint cross bearing has excellent rotation accuracy.
2, joint cross bearing operation installation simplification: is divided into 2 parts of the outer ring or inner ring, after loading the roller and the retainer, is fixed together, so the installation is very simple.
3. The joint cross bearing is subjected to large axial and radial loads: because the rollers are vertically aligned with each other through the spacers on the 90° V-groove rolling surface, this design allows the crossed roller bearings to be It is subjected to loads in all directions such as radial load, axial load and moment load.
4, joint cross bearing greatly saves installation space: the size of the inner and outer rings like ZYSL crossed roller bearings is minimized, especially the ultra-thin structure is close to the limit of small size, and has high rigidity, so it is most suitable for industrial robots A wide range of applications such as joint parts or rotating parts, rotary tables for machining centers, robot rotating parts, precision rotary tables, medical instruments, measuring instruments, and IC manufacturing equipment.

5.joint cross bearing high speed capability.
6.joint cross bearing reduces shaft length and machining costs, and thermal expansion results in limited variations in geometry.
7.joint cross bearing adopts nylon separator, low moment of inertia, low starting torque and easy to control angular division.
8.joint cross bearing optimizes the pre-tightening force, the rigidity is large, and the guiding roller runs with high precision.
9.joint cross bearing carburized steel provides excellent impact resistance and surface abrasion resistance.
10.joint cross bearing is simple but fully lubricated = the groove rolling surfaces are arranged perpendicular to each other by spacers. This design allows the crossed roller bearings to withstand large radial loads, axial loads and moment loads. Directional load.
